Victoria Robinson, aka Victoria Louise MUA, is a freelance MUA and educator teaching the next generation of Beauty Therapists and MUAs. She has been in the Industry for 24 years and has won numerous awards for her make up skills. Her work includes TV, Film & Theatre as well as working freelance on weddings for a number of years. She has a real passion for what she does.
While she was judging at the Warpaint Extra National Student Makeup Competition and demonstrating on our live stage we had a delve in her kit bag to see what she can’t live without.
Isoclean Makeup Brush Cleanser (from £8) – sanitises brushes and palettes without being too harsh. They also do eco refill pouches and supply hand sanitiser and surface cleaner etc. It is also vegan and cruelty free
P Louise Base (£10) – This product gives the eye a perfect base to apply your shadows. You can also use as a concealer so is multi use which is perfect in your kit
Charlotte Tilbury Beautiful Skin Foundation (£36) – This foundation is amazing for any skin type and gives that on trend glow to the skin while providing just enough coverage
My Kit Co Brush Buddy (from £31.50) – This brush buddy makes carrying my brushes round easier and also keeps them clean. They also do a range of bags to keep palettes and equipment in. So good when you’re on the go or on set
Jordana Ticia Set and Brighten Powder (from £16) – A new kit staple for me. This product is dual purpose as it contains a pressed powder on top and a loose powder on the bottom. It comes in a range of colours to suit all skin tones and is stunning on the skin.
B Perfect Carnival Palette XL Pro (£41.95) – The carnival palette series is epic. The XL pro is the perfect Palette for colour and natural tones. It also contains 3 highlighter colours. The colours blend seamlessly and are really easy to work with.
Peaches And Cream PC10 Brush (£5) – my favourite brush is my PC10 brush which is the perfect blending brush for the eyes. The dome shape top makes blending shadow so easy
Doll Beauty Double Booked Lipstick (£13) – My go to lipstick for a Nude lip. The colour suits everyone and the texture is so creamy
Lashes by Victoria Louise (from £6) – Although I use a range of lashes for different looks I love using my own brand lashes. They are cruelty free and reusable up to 20 times and come in 9 different styles so there is something to suit everyone.
Duo Eyelash Glue (from £4.90) – When applying lashes I always use Duo glue as it never lets me down. I prefer to use the clear/ transparent one.
